Eagle Pass gave their fans exactly what they wanted out of a home opener on Friday. They blew past the Winn Mavericks 48-0 at home. Given the Eagles' advantage in MaxPreps' Texas football rankings (they are ranked 512th, while the Mavericks are ranked 1154th), the result wasn't entirely unexpected.
Eagle Pass was led to victory by Luis Flores and Xavier Barrera. Flores rushed for 72 yards and four touchdowns, while Barrera threw for 216 yards and two touchdowns. A healthy portion of that aerial production (84 yards to be exact) went to Sebastian Velasquez, who also brought in a receiving touchdown.
Perhaps unsurprisingly given the score, Eagle Pass was moving up and down the field and finished the game with 462 total yards. They easily outclassed their opponents in that department as Winn only gained 75.
